I usually buy Jack's Links because I like the flavor. The loose jerky, original style (serving size 1 oz), has 80 calories, 1 gram of fat, 3 carbs, and 15 grams of protein. It's been my go-to snack for a while and I've not had any problems.

I love fruit like strawberries, kiwi, apples, and oranges but tend to go over board. A few of my other favorite snacks include:
-1 serving of tuna (about 1/4 cup) on thomas' whole wheat bagel thins=170 cals
-2 full graham crackers with a tbsp of natural peanut butter= 225cals
-1/2 cup edamame= 120 cals
-1 cup dry cereal like cheerios multigrain= 110 cals
-Sugar free chocolate pudding cups= 60 cals
-100 calorie snack packs chocolate covered pretzels (my fave!)
